Do you use fabric softener? Fabric softener and some liquid detergents used improperly can get gunked up inside the holes of the agitator, under the wash plate, in the dispenser, etc. where you can not see it. I used to occasionally use fabric softener, and I quit doing it for that reason. The other reason is fabric softeners and dryer sheets coat clothing. This can make it more difficult for detergent and water to penetrate the fabric during the next wash cycle. I occasionally use scent boosters now and haven't noticed the issue return. A shot of Dawn dishwashing soap can help with heavier soiled items like those used to work on autos. For those gym clothes and stuff like that, vinegar instead of fabric softener seems to help.
For those clothes that seem to hold odor, I have to say my front load with the heated water "sani cycle" seemed to work better. Without bleach, that cycle on my LG would remove mildew, pet accidents, and gym/yardwork clothes odor better.
